Im a beginner and I will be shooting amateur and pro motocross and super cross, along with occasional drag cars. I also have a two year old and a newborn i want to start shooting, which camera should i choose?

    9 months ago Jacob-Medinilla recommends the Canon EOS 7D

    Forsomething moving so fast, youwould need a great autofocussystem. Something that doesn't come cheap. The7D would be my obvious choice,thoughit may cost more than youwould liketo spend.There is a reasonall those sports andaction shooters use7D and1D bodies.

    9 months ago Harri-Heikkil recommends the Pentax K-5

    I would recommend neither of these. Instead choose the sports/wildlife oriented EOS 7D (like Jacob said) OR a more affordable and better general photography choice, the Pentax K-5.
